import React from "react";
import { Cpu, X, Maximize2 } from "lucide-react";
import { Progress } from "@/components/ui/progress.tsx";
import { useTranslation } from "react-i18next";
import type { ServerMetrics } from "@/ui/main-axios.ts";
import type { WidgetSize } from "@/types/stats-widgets";
import { ChartContainer, RechartsPrimitive } from "@/components/ui/chart.tsx";
const {
LineChart,
Line,
XAxis,
YAxis,
CartesianGrid,
Tooltip,
ResponsiveContainer,
} = RechartsPrimitive;
interface CpuWidgetProps {
metrics: ServerMetrics | null;
metricsHistory: ServerMetrics[];
isEditMode: boolean;
widgetId: string;
widgetSize: WidgetSize;
onDelete: (widgetId: string, e: React.MouseEvent<HTMLButtonElement>) => void;
onChangeSize: (
widgetId: string,
newSize: WidgetSize,
e: React.MouseEvent<HTMLButtonElement>,
) => void;
}
export function CpuWidget({
metrics,
metricsHistory,
isEditMode,
widgetId,
widgetSize,
onDelete,
onChangeSize,
}: CpuWidgetProps) {
const { t } = useTranslation();
const sizeOrder: WidgetSize[] = ["small", "medium", "large"];
const nextSize =
sizeOrder[(sizeOrder.indexOf(widgetSize) + 1) % sizeOrder.length];
// Prepare chart data
const chartData = React.useMemo(() => {
return metricsHistory.map((m, index) => ({
index,
cpu: m.cpu?.percent || 0,
}));
}, [metricsHistory]);
return (
<div className="h-full w-full p-4 rounded-lg bg-dark-bg/50 border border-dark-border/50 hover:bg-dark-bg/70 transition-colors duration-200 flex flex-col overflow-hidden">
{isEditMode && (
<>
<button
onClick={(e) => onChangeSize(widgetId, nextSize, e)}
onPointerDown={(e) => e.stopPropagation()}
onMouseDown={(e) => e.stopPropagation()}
className="absolute top-2 right-11 z-[9999] w-7 h-7 bg-blue-500/90 hover:bg-blue-600 text-white rounded-full flex items-center justify-center cursor-pointer shadow-lg"
type="button"
title={`Change to ${nextSize}`}
>
<Maximize2 className="h-4 w-4" />
</button>
<button
onClick={(e) => onDelete(widgetId, e)}
onPointerDown={(e) => e.stopPropagation()}
onMouseDown={(e) => e.stopPropagation()}
className="absolute top-2 right-2 z-[9999] w-7 h-7 bg-red-500/90 hover:bg-red-600 text-white rounded-full flex items-center justify-center cursor-pointer shadow-lg"
type="button"
>
<X className="h-4 w-4" />
</button>
</>
)}
<div
className={`flex items-center gap-2 flex-shrink-0 mb-3 ${isEditMode ? "drag-handle cursor-move" : ""}`}
>
<Cpu className="h-5 w-5 text-blue-400" />
<h3 className="font-semibold text-lg text-white">CPU Usage</h3>
</div>
{widgetSize === "small" && (
<div className="flex flex-col items-center justify-center flex-1">
<div className="text-4xl font-bold text-blue-400">
{typeof metrics?.cpu?.percent === "number"
? `${metrics.cpu.percent}%`
: "N/A"}
</div>
<div className="text-sm text-gray-400 mt-2">
{typeof metrics?.cpu?.cores === "number"
? t("serverStats.cpuCores", { count: metrics.cpu.cores })
: t("serverStats.naCpus")}
</div>
</div>
)}
{widgetSize === "medium" && (
<div className="space-y-2">
<div className="flex justify-between items-center">
<span className="text-sm text-gray-300">
{(() => {
const pct = metrics?.cpu?.percent;
const cores = metrics?.cpu?.cores;
const pctText = typeof pct === "number" ? `${pct}%` : "N/A";
const coresText =
typeof cores === "number"
? t("serverStats.cpuCores", { count: cores })
: t("serverStats.naCpus");
return `${pctText} ${t("serverStats.of")} ${coresText}`;
})()}
</span>
</div>
<div className="relative">
<Progress
value={
typeof metrics?.cpu?.percent === "number"
? metrics!.cpu!.percent!
: 0
}
className="h-2"
/>
</div>
<div className="text-xs text-gray-500">
{metrics?.cpu?.load
? `Load: ${metrics.cpu.load[0].toFixed(2)}, ${metrics.cpu.load[1].toFixed(2)}, ${metrics.cpu.load[2].toFixed(2)}`
: "Load: N/A"}
</div>
</div>
)}
{widgetSize === "large" && (
<div className="flex flex-col flex-1 min-h-0 gap-2">
<div className="flex items-baseline gap-3 flex-shrink-0">
<div className="text-2xl font-bold text-blue-400">
{typeof metrics?.cpu?.percent === "number"
? `${metrics.cpu.percent}%`
: "N/A"}
</div>
<div className="text-xs text-gray-400">
{typeof metrics?.cpu?.cores === "number"
? t("serverStats.cpuCores", { count: metrics.cpu.cores })
: t("serverStats.naCpus")}
</div>
</div>
<div className="text-xs text-gray-500 flex-shrink-0">
{metrics?.cpu?.load
? `Load: ${metrics.cpu.load[0].toFixed(2)} / ${metrics.cpu.load[1].toFixed(2)} / ${metrics.cpu.load[2].toFixed(2)}`
: "Load: N/A"}
</div>
<div className="flex-1 min-h-0">
<ResponsiveContainer width="100%" height="100%">
<LineChart data={chartData}>
<CartesianGrid strokeDasharray="3 3" stroke="#374151" />
<XAxis
dataKey="index"
stroke="#9ca3af"
tick={{ fill: "#9ca3af" }}
hide
/>
<YAxis
domain={[0, 100]}
stroke="#9ca3af"
tick={{ fill: "#9ca3af" }}
/>
<Tooltip
contentStyle={{
backgroundColor: "#1f2937",
border: "1px solid #374151",
borderRadius: "6px",
color: "#fff",
}}
formatter={(value: number) => [`${value.toFixed(1)}%`, "CPU"]}
/>
<Line
type="monotone"
dataKey="cpu"
stroke="#60a5fa"
strokeWidth={2}
dot={false}
animationDuration={300}
/>
</LineChart>
</ResponsiveContainer>
</div>
</div>
)}
</div>
);
}
